Output 17f8659eeccbe036689dee15aeb7f92fcbefdae7eb090df78e162c02b8aec346:1

value
11827408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7feebf204d4773f004d75d48d4a7e6bd33a2251 OP_EQUAL
address
3H1J9r5aADgVs7PS3a74hqXTADz5W7FSeu
transaction
17f8659eeccbe036689dee15aeb7f92fcbefdae7eb090df78e162c02b8aec346
confirmations
332447
spent
true